8 MOVES TO SHAKE OFF STRESS & ANXIETY

This following sequence is designed to help you train your nervous system to swing harmoniously and healthily between activated and relaxed states, and to respond better to stress. Some of these practices stimulate the vagus nerve – the winding nerve that runs from your brain down to your intestines, and which is key in regulating your nervous system – while others safely increase your resilience, or induce relaxation.
